MỤC LỤC BÀI VIẾT
Làm thế nào để các bước làm 1 trang web hoàn chỉnh trở nên dễ dàng?
Hiện nay, việc xây dựng một trang web đang trở nên khá phổ biến. Nhưng không phải ai cũng có thể thực hiện các bước làm 1 trang web hoàn chỉnh được. Bài viết hôm nay chúng tôi sẽ giới thiệu đến các bạn cách lập một trang web trở nên vô cùng dễ dàng. Cùng blog.az9s.com tìm hiểu thêm một số thôn g tin sau đây nhé!
1. Website là gì ?
Website hay một trang web là một thư mục chứa các tệp là các siêu văn bản được lưu trữ tại các máy chủ, mỗi siêu văn bản được liên kết tới một đường dẫn url. Hay nói cách khác, website là một tập hợp của các page bao gồm văn bản, hình ảnh, video, ứng dụng… mỗi website thường chỉ nằm trên một địa chỉ domain (tên miền), có thể là tên miền chính hoặc các sub-domain. Nơi lưu trữ các trang web là các hosting nằm trên các máy chủ, người ta có thể truy cập vào trang web bằng các kết nối internet.
Mục đích xây dựng website là để cung cấp thông tin, quảng bá thương hiệu, hoặc kinh doanh thương mại. Dù mục đích là gì thì để có một website cần thực hiện các bước xây dựng website để cho ra một website phục vụ mục đích của mình.
2. Các bước để làm 1 trang web hoàn chỉnh
2.1 Tên miền
Tên miền chính là một địa chỉ định danh trên internet để thay thế cho địa chỉ IP khó nhớ. Tên miền sẽ giúp cho việc định danh doanh nghiệp hay cá nhân trên internet được dễ dàng hơn. Để bắt đầu các bước thiết kế 1 trang web của mình, đa phần bạn phải nghĩ đến tên miền đầu tiên. Cho đến ngày nay việc đăng ký tên miền đã trở nên nhẹ nhàng không còn quá cầu kỳ như trước. Việc sở hữu một tên miền cũng vô cùng đơn giản, không nên lựa chọn những tên miền đẹp đã bị đăng ký hết. Bạn chỉ cần tập trung tối đa vào việc suy nghĩ đến một tên miền ngắn gọn, dễ nhớ.
2.2 Webhosting
Khi đã có một tên miền cho riêng mình thì bạn chuyển đến nơi lưu trữ trang web. Bạn cần lưu trữ tên miền lại giống như lưu trữ một vật trong nhà. Và chính ngôi nhà này sẽ chứa trang web của bạn. các công đoạn thiết kế web cũng không hề quá khó. Ngôi nhà của bạn càng lớn sẽ càng chứa được nhiều đồ đạc. Đối với dịch vụ webhosting thì dung lượng càng lớn bạn chứa được media càng nhiều.
Hiện nay, dịch vụ webhosting chủ yếu có 2 dạng là webhosting linux và webhosting window. Trong đó dạng webhosting linux chiếm số lượng máy chủ lớn nhờ tiết kiệm được chi phí triển khai cũng như phí phần mềm bản quyền.
Đối với việc lập trình thì lập trình trên ngôn ngữ nào cũng vậy, quan trọng nhất là người lập trình chứ không phải ngôn ngữ lập trình. Một trang web được bảo mật phải dựa vào rất nhiều yếu tố khác nhau. Với những trang web có số lượng người lớn thường sử dụng máy chủ để cho việc hoạt động trang web trơn tru được đảm bảo. Đồng thời các trang web thương mại điện tử sẽ có thể có một hệ thống server hoạt động một cách riêng lẻ và độc lập. Thông thường những người sử dụng dịch vụ chỗ đặt máy chủ, tự lắp ráp server sẽ mang đến các trung tâm dữ liệu để đặt vào máy chủ của họ.
2.3 Cài đặt dịch vụ mail
Khi thực hiện các bước xây dựng website và đã có tên miền, webhosting thì một số webhosting sẽ cho phép bạn khởi tạo email dưới dạng yourname@yourdomain.com. Nhưng chủ yếu email hoạt động không ổn định do công việc chính của webhosting là chạy trang web.
Bạn có thể sử dụng dịch vụ email cá nhân hoặc email doanh nghiệp tùy theo nhu cầu mà bạn dùng cho hoạt động kinh doanh của mình.
2.4 Nhận diện thương hiệu
Khi xây dựng trang web cần chú trọng đến việc nhận diện thương hiệu. Nhận diện thương hiệu ngay từ đầu là việc cần thiết cho các doanh nghiệp và sản phẩm của doanh nghiệp. Để tạo nên một trang web với cá tính và phong cách riêng bạn cần có một công ty tư vấn cho bạn về việc nhận diện thương hiệu và cách xây dựng bộ nhận diện thương hiệu.
2.5 Thiết kế website
Khi các bước trên hoàn thiện, công việc tiếp theo là các bước thiết kế giao diện website của bạn sẽ đơn giản hơn nhiều. Đầu tiên cần tập trung hình ảnh, nội dung theo một bố cục nhất định. Sau đó bạn thiết kế trang web để bắt đầu đưa sản phẩm dịch vụ của mình lên internet.
Bạn có thể tìm đến các công ty thiết kế web uy tín để công việc thiết kế web trở nên dễ dàng hơn. Hay bạn có thể sử dụng một mã nguồn tải miễn phí về để tạo ra trang web cho bạn.
3. Bạn cần làm gì để xây dựng một trang web theo các bước làm 1 trang web hoàn chỉnh
Ngoài những thứ quan trọng khác mà bạn phải chuẩn bị ra như domain, web host, chủ đề trang web, chiến lược phát triển thì công cụ để xây dựng lên một trang web cũng rất quan trọng. Dưới đây là một số công cụ tối thiểu mà một nhà thiết kế tương lai như bạn phải cần đến.
3.1 Một máy tính nối mạng tại nhà
Nếu như bạn không có máy tính nối mạng tại nhà thì việc quản lý các trang web của bạn sẽ trở nên rất khó khăn. Tuy không phải là không thể làm được, nhưng mỗi khi cần viết bài, chỉnh sửa hay trả lời comments, email mà bạn phải chờ đến lúc đi ra được tiệm internet thì tốn khá nhiều thời gian và không hiệu quả. Hơn nữa, việc quản lý trang web này lại chứa nhiều thông tin nhạy cảm như password admin, mật khẩu quản lý trang web, database, credit card, emails mà được làm ở chỗ đông người là rất nguy hiểm. Những người xấu có thể lợi dụng sơ hở đó của bạn và ăn cắp thông tin nhạy cảm để chuộc lợi.
3.2 Công cụ upload files lên mạng
Đây là công cụ không thể thiếu nằm trong các bước thiết kế website bán hàng của các webmaster. Bởi nó đóng một vai trò là cầu nối giữa máy tính của bạn và trang web. Nếu bạn muốn download hoặc upload cái gì từ máy chủ lên trang web và ngược lại, thì bạn phải cần đến nó.
3.3 Phần mềm chỉnh sửa ảnh
Khi đã sử dụng web là bạn sẽ phải làm việc với các hình ảnh. Nhưng đôi khi bạn cần cắt giảm kích thước của hình hay tăng độ sáng và xoá vết nhơ thì những công cụ đơn giản và miễn phí sẽ cho phép bạn thực hiện việc này. Và sau này bạn cũng cần đến những công cụ mang tính chất mạnh hơn cho phép bạn thiết kế banner, hình ảnh của riêng mình. Thậm chí làm hẳn một giao diện cho mình trong quy trình thiết kế website. Đa phần các trang web đều sử dụng phần mềm Adobe Photoshop. Phần mềm này là công cụ rất mạnh cho phép bạn biến những ý tưởng sáng tạo ở trong đầu thành hình ảnh. Khả năng của Adobe Photoshop là vô biên.
3.4 Hệ thống quản lý nội dung tuỳ chọn
Đây là phần không bị bắt buộc bởi vì nó tuỳ thuộc vào nhu cầu của bạn mà bạn nên mua những phần mềm hợp lý. Nhưng nếu bạn không yêu cầu cao chỉ làm một trang web tĩnh đơn giản, thì có thể chỉ cần mỗi Notepad là đủ. Hoặc nếu bạn còn chưa thành thạo về HTML hoặc CSS, bạn có thể download phần mềm Dreamweaver để thay thế. Đây cũng là công cụ khá mạnh và trực quan, giúp cho bạn tạo ra những trang web HTML.
4. Xác định đối tượng người đọc để thực hiện các bước làm 1 trang web hoàn chỉnh
Một phần vô cùng quan trọng trong việc thành lập một trang web đó chính là bạn phải biết rõ ai sẽ là người sử dụng trang web của bạn, đọc những gì bạn viết. Những người đó chính là nhóm người đọc của bạn. Việc xác định chính xác nhóm người đọc này, sẽ mang lại cho bạn nhiều lợi ích, đóng góp một phần không nhỏ vào thành công của quy trình xây dựng website sau này.
Để xác định đối tượng người đọc sẽ vào trang web của bạn sau này, bạn cần nghĩ ngay đến chủ đề của mình đang viết thu hút những ai. Vì thế bạn cần chia họ ra thành những hạng mục sau.
4.1 Giới tính
Giới tính có ảnh hưởng rất nhiều đến các thói quen lướt web. Các bạn gái thích những trang có nội dung nhẹ nhàng như phim online, âm nhạc, các diễn đàn sôi động. Họ ít chú ý tới những trang web về đồ hoạ, vi tính hay ô tô, xe máy. Ngược lại, đối với các bạn nam thì lại thích tham gia vào những trang web mang tính nặng về kỹ thuật hơn là giải trí. Yếu tố này sẽ giúp bạn xác định rõ đối tượng người đọc của bạn là nam hay nữ. Từ việc xác định đó bạn có thể đưa ra những quyết định về thiết kế giao diện, quảng cáo sao cho phù hợp với đối tượng người đọc này.
4.2 Độ tuổi
Ở những người có độ tuổi khác nhau thì có những sở thích cũng khác nhau. Khi còn nhỏ bạn thường thích đọc truyện tranh, xem phim hoạt hình. Khi lớn lên bạn lại có xu hướng thích đọc tiểu thuyết dài và xem phim hành động. Trưởng thành hơn nữa bạn lại thích đọc sách về triết lý sống, xem những bộ phim tài liệu về chiến tranh. Chính yếu tố này giúp bạn xác định được đối tượng người đọc thích cái gì và họ chờ đón điều gì ở trang web của bạn.
4.3 Trình độ văn hoá
Người có trình độ văn hoá khác nhau nên cách tiếp cận vấn đề cũng khác nhau. Do vậy khi viết, diễn đạt một ý tưởng nào đó thì bạn nên chọn ngôn ngữ bình dân nhất, phổ biến nhất. Nếu dùng quá nhiều từ chuyên ngành và mỹ từ, sẽ khiến họ không hiểu được ý bạn muốn nói.
4.4 Nghề nghiệp
Nghề nghiệp cũng quyết định khá lớn đến cách tạo một trang web miễn phí của mỗi người. Nó cũng là ảnh hưởng ít nhiều đến sở thích của họ. Khi biết được họ thích cái gì, nghề nghiệp của họ là gì, điều đó sẽ giúp bạn rất nhiều trong việc viết nội dung cho trang web của mình.
Nếu biết được chính xác đối tượng người đọc là ai bạn sẽ giải quyết được những vấn đề như là màu sắc của trang web, thiết kế giao diện, font chữ phù hợp, nội dung và văn phong cách viết. Khi bạn đã thoả mãn về những yêu cầu từ phía người đọc của bạn thì bạn đã thành công được một nửa rồi.
5. Các bước thiết kế 1 trang web
Để thiết kế một trang web, cần thực hiện theo các bước cụ thể. Các bước này đã được các chuyên gia lập trình nghiên cứu và sử dụng để lập kế hoạch, thực hiện các công đoạn thiết kế web hiệu quả, chuyên nghiệp nhất. Hơn thế, quá trình thiết kế web cần tạo những để tiến hành quảng bá và SEO website khi đưa vào sử dụng.
5.1 Thu thập thông tin
Để thực hiện bước này cần trả lời câu hỏi, mục đích của xây dựng website là gì? Đối tượng hướng đến của website là ai? Nội dung trọng tâm và hướng đến của website là gì? Từ đó, tìm cách thu thập đầy đủ các thông tin liên quan, căn cứ trên các định hướng ban đầu để tránh đi chệch hướng trong quá trình thiết kế website.
5.2 Lập kế hoạch
Sau khi thu thập được đầy đủ nhất thông tin liên quan đến trang web, hãy hệ thống những thông tin mình nắm trong tay lại với nhau và lập một kế hoạch các bước thiết kế website thật chi tiết. Đầu tiên là thực hiện phác thảo sơ đồ cho website. Tiếp đến, bạn hãy liệt kê thành một danh sách tất cả những chủ đề chính, chủ đề phụ, những trang chính, những trang phụ mà bạn muốn nó xuất hiện trên trang web của mình. Xác định nội dung cụ thể xây dựng cho từng trang. Việc lập kế hoạch, lên danh sách sẽ giúp bạn có cái nhìn từ tổng quát đến chi tiết các việc cần làm đối với trang web của mình, mà không bị bỏ sót bất kỳ yếu tố nào. Tuy nhiên, dù bản đồ website của bạn có như thế nào thì đó cũng là ý kiến cá nhân của bạn, hãy nhớ rằng trải nghiệm người dùng luôn là ưu tiên hàng đầu, hãy thiết kế một trang web hướng đến người dùng. Do vậy, tham khảo các website khác trong quá trình lên kế hoạch để đảm bảo các thiết kế trên trang của bạn tạo thuận tiện và dễ dàng nhất cho người sử dụng để truy cập, tìm kiếm thông tin.
5.3 Tiến hành thiết kế
Với bước 3, quá trình thiết kế dần định hình lên trang web. Việc đầu tiên là bắt tay thiết kế giao diện trang web của bạn. Giao diện là thứ mà người dùng tương tác khi truy cập trang web. Một số lưu ý khi thiết kế web: Trước tiên cần xác định đối tượng mục tiêu của trang web là ai. Lựa chon giao diện website phù hợp với đặc điểm lứa tuổi, tâm sinh lý, giới tính, một trang web dành cho các bạn trẻ sẽ khác so với một website dành cho các nhà đầu tư, các chủ doanh nghiệp trong lĩnh vực tài chính. Cần đảm bảo việc thiết kế website thống nhất với bộ nhận diện thương hiệu của công ty về màu sắc, slogan hay logo của công ty bạn. Cuối cùng, nên đưa ra nhiều lựa chọn cho giao diện trang web, yêu cầu người thiết kế trang của bạn đưa ra ít nhất 3 mẫu thiết kế khác nhau dựa trên những ý tưởng có sẵn. Từ đó có cơ sở để so sánh và đánh giá chính xác hơn về những ý tưởng dành cho trang web của công ty mình và tìm ra một phương án tối ưu nhất.
5.4 Phát triển website
Ở giai đoạn thứ 4, là giai đoạn đưa trang web vào hoạt động, thực tế giai đoạn này hoàn toàn có thể tiến hành song song với giai đoạn 3. Toàn bộ giai đoạn này tập trung thực hiện những ý tưởng, xây dựng chức năng cần thiết cho website. Cần lưu ý là cần luôn theo sát đội lập trình web, để thường xuyên kiểm tra tiến độ và điều chỉnh điểm bất hợp lý ngay khi cần. Việc bạn hiểu biết về lập trình cũng là một lợi thế, vì như vậy bạn có thể đặt ra những nguyên tắc lập trình ngay từ ban đầu cho quá trình phát triển trang web, nhờ vậy mà code trang web sẽ được viết theo đúng chuẩn, và có cơ sở để chỉnh sửa, cập nhất website sau này. Do vậy, nếu không có kiến thức lập trình, bạn cũng nên thuê riêng một người để theo dõi việc lập trình web để có thể sát sao trong công việc và có chỉnh sửa, điều chỉnh hợp lý.
5.5 Kiểm tra và chỉnh sửa website
Đây là bước vô cùng quan trọng trong quá trình thiết kế web, đối với các website Việt Nam thao tác này ít được coi trọng, các trang web sau khi thiết kế xong được đưa vào sử dụng ngay mà không trải qua các bước kiểm tra bởi các tester. Việc kiểm tra của các tester là vô cùng quan trọng, bởi trong quá trình xây dựng web không thể lường hết được những vấn đề mà trang có thể gặp phải, hay những bất tiện gây cho khách hàng, do đó trước khi đưa vào sử dụng chính thức, cần có thời gian để chạy thử nghiệm và tìm ra những lỗi, khiếm khuyết của trang web và tiến hành khắc phục kịp thời. Thao tác kiểm tra chạy thử website dưới sử giám sát của các tester là bắt buộc trong quá trình thiết kế web.
5.6 Bảo trì website
Quá trình thiết kế web không chỉ dừng lại ở việc đưa trang web chạy chính thức trên môi trường internet, mà một website chuyên nghiệp không thể thiếu bước bảo trì định kỳ. Quá trình bảo trì sẽ giúp khắc phục những lỗi tiềm ẩn chưa phát hiện được trong quá trình chạy thử nghiệm. Bên cạnh đó, các website cũng cần được cập nhật lại các ứng dụng mới, thiết thực như các bảo mật trang web, cập nhật lại các phiên bản mới của ứng dụng để quá trình sử dụng web đạt hiệu quả cao nhất và thuận tiện nhất chon người sử dụng.
Nhiều người nghĩ rằng quá trình thiết kế website đã kết thúc ngay sau khi website được launch ra thị trường. Thế nhưng, một website chuyên nghiệp là website sẽ phải trải qua thêm bước thứ 6 – bảo trì. Cho dù website của bạn được thiết kế, kiểm tra và chỉnh sửa kỹ càng như thế nào thì vẫn luôn có những lỗi hỏng. Không những thế, trong suốt quá trình vận hành, chắc chắn bạn sẽ nhận được nhiều phản hồi của khách hàng và bạn cần chỉnh sửa website theo những phản hồi đó. Vì vậy, hãy lập kế hoạch và định ra thời gian cụ thể để cập nhật website. Đó có thể là 3 tháng, 6 tháng hay 1 năm. Cho dù là thời hạn bao lâu đi nữa thì hãy chắc chắn bạn sẽ thường xuyên bảo trì và cập nhật website của mình.
Hy vọng với những kiến thức về các bước làm 1 trang web hoàn chỉnh sẽ giúp bạn hoạt động trang web của mình một cách hiệu quả. Việc hoàn thiện một trang web hoàn chỉnh không phải là quá khó, chỉ cần có đầy đủ kinh nghiệm và viết cách học hỏi là bạn sẽ làm được. Như vậy, bài viết này đã trình bày tổng quát về cách xây dựng 1 trang web thông thường và một trang web bán hàng. Những thông tin này sẽ giúp bạn định hình được việc xây dựng các website ra sao, và các bước cần tiến hành cụ thể như thế nào. Mọi thắc mắc bạn hãy liên hệ để được giải đáp. Chúc các bạn luôn thành công.